This exquisite watercolor on parchment image is taken from Livre I des annales, also known as the "Annals of Toulouse," created between 1295 and 1532. The specific section depicted here is Les portraits des capitouls de l'annee 1353-1354, showcasing the portraits of the Capitouls, or magistrates, of Toulouse during that year. The Capitouls were an essential part of the municipal government in medieval Toulouse, and their portraits were meticulously recorded in the annals. The anonymous artist skillfully rendered each portrait in watercolor, capturing the unique features and expressions of the individuals. Their attire reflects the fashion and social status of the time, providing a valuable insight into the lives of the ruling class during the late medieval period. The intricate details and vibrant colors of the artwork are a testament to the artist's mastery of the medium and the importance placed on recording history through visual means. This image is a rare and precious find, preserved in the Archives municipales de Toulouse, a testament to the rich history and cultural heritage of the city. The annals themselves are a valuable resource for historians, offering insights into the political, social, and cultural developments in Toulouse during the Middle Ages. The portraits of the Capitouls serve as a reminder of the individuals who shaped the city's history and the importance of preserving historical records for future generations.
